4D Ajax Framework es un framework multicapas con integración profunda dentro del entorno 4D. Ha sido diseñado para complementar el entorno de desarrollo 4D existente. Los frameworks Ajax que no son específicos del sistema no tienen el mismo nivel de integración. Trabajan bien en funciones básicas pero son menos útiles en integración o desarrollo en profundidad de aplicaciones 4D. Por ejemplo, 4D Ajax Framework reconoce y puede utilizar una estructura de seguridad 4D de usuario/grupo existente. Otros frameworks no.
Nada. Necesita añadir un componente a la aplicación, pero no es necesario tocar el resto de su estructura de datos.
No. Estamos introduciendo 4D Ajax Framework para darle más opciones, no menos. Utilizando un navegador Web como un 4D client significa una opción adicional al lado de la utilización del 4D Client existente.
No hay una razón por la que no deba hacerlo. Sin embargo, hay algunas cosas que 4DAF hace que otros frameworks simplemente no ofrecen. Por ejemplo, hemos concentrado 4D Ajax Framework en ofrecer manejo de consultas y organización de datos poderosos, tales como nuestro árbol de datos y controles de calendario.
4D Ajax Framework ha sido optimizado para ser utilizado con 4D. Puede utilizar otra base de datos para su almacenamiento si 4D actúa como una capa de procesamiento (middleware), pero no fue diseñado para conexión directa con otra fuente de datos.
Las aplicaciones Web 4D pueden ejecutarse en cualquiera de los dos, siempre y cuando tenga una copia de 4D Web Server.
Sí, ¡por su puesto! Siempre y cuando tenga una licencia de 4D Web Server. Pensamos que una vez haya probado las herramientas que ofrece 4D Ajax Framework, le gustarán tanto que no querrá hacer desarrollo Web sin ellas, pero no son necesarias para desarrollar aplicaciones Web enriquecidas con 4D.
4D Web 2.0 Pack es una herramienta de desarrollo, de manera que debe comprar la versión de 4D Web 2.0 Pack que trabajará con el producto con el que desarrolla. Despliegue "Hassle-free" significa que no tiene que preocupares por cual versión de 4D están utilizando sus clientes.
Si decide no continuar con su suscripción, aún tendrá acceso total a la versión del software que tiene actualmente y éste continuará funcionando. Sin embargo, no tendrá acceso a arreglos de bugs, nuevas funcionalidades, o nuevas partes del producto que lancemos una ves su suscripción termine.
Si deja de suscribirse y luego decide retomar una suscripción después de que la actual haya terminado, usted puede ponerse al día llamando a su distribuidor 4D o a Servicio al cliente 4D.
Hay tres cosas que deberá hacer:
Actualización del componente 4D Ajax Framework:
Actualización de la librería y del cliente 4D Ajax Framework:
Activación de su actualización:
Si está implementando su aplicación utilizando el cliente integrado a 4D Ajax Framework, no. La versión 1.1 asegura una compatibilidad ascendente.
Sin embargo, si ha realizado una personalización extensiva de las características y métodos existentes en su aplicación Web, usted podría notar algunos pequeños problemas debidos a las nuevas características que hemos añadido al API. Todos los cambios al API han sido documentados en el wiki de 4D Web 2.0 Pack, de manera que si tiene alguna duda, por favor consulte el wiki o contacte soporte técnico.
4D Ajax Framework es parte de 4D Web 2.0 Pack.